| > On Wed, 17 Apr 2002, Defryn, Guy wrote:
| > > At the moment all our printers our network printers and they run on
| > > 2000 server .
| > >
| > > I want to setup all the HP printers on Freebsd. All our users are on
| > > windows machines.
| > >
| > > What's the best way to start?
| >
| > People have been recommending Samba and various sorts of print filters,
| > but you may not need that level of complexity.  The "serious" branch of
| > Windows (NT) can send lpr print jobs.  Attach the printers to your
| > FreeBSD machine.  Define the queues in /etc/printcap.  Install the
| > various drivers on the Windows machines, and set them to print to an lpr
| > "port" which is really the FreeBSD print queue.
|
| But you would still need samba - wouldn't you?

Windows understands IP, and per this post, it understands lpr as well, so why 
would you?
